I have been playing with Catheine Pooler`s Two Part Hearts stamps and dies along with my favourite inks by Catherine Pooler!



I started off by stamping and die cutting a bunch of hearts in coordinating colours. I used the CP colour wheel to help me choose. I covered all my card fronts with aqua cardstock, the inside white panel is 5 1/8" x 3 7/8". I stamped an old sentiment from Papertrey Ink and all my cards using Catherine Pooler Mardi Gras ink. Next I attached the white panels to the card front using strips of foam tape. Then I arranged my stamped hearts on the the tops of the white panel using foam tape. The dimension adds so much to the cards.








I ended up making 2 of each card.

 For my first card I used the adorable Hot Dog Stamp Set. This sweet little pup laying in a bun was my first choice to ink up. I stamped him in black ink and clear embossed the lines before I coloured him with Copic Markers. I cut my panel with the second largest Lawn Fawn Large Stitched rectangle, I added the sentiment also from the set and popped it up with foam tape before adding it to a red panel.

I couldn't let the fun end there, so I made a second card using just the pile of rocks and sentiments from the You Rock stamp set. When I have a small focal point making a 4 1/4" square card base works perfectly. The inner white panel is 3 1/4" square. Once again I stamped and clear embossed the images before colouring with Copic markers. I gave the rocks a bit of shine with a Clear Wink of Stella Glitter Brush.


I added a second sentiment on the inside of the card!

I used an old favourite, wood block stamp made by Hero Arts called Dots & Flowers to make my patterned piece. Really simple, I opened my mini MISTI and lay the stamp on its back on the mat. Then I inked my stamps up well with VersaFine Onyx black ink. To make my impression I lay my cardstock on to the inked stamp and rubbed all over the stamp to get a good impression and Peeled in off--Voila!

I have kept all of my favourite woodblock stamps. I don't use them very often, but when I do I am amazed by the quality of the impression. Did you keep yours???
